Overview

The early life of the American automotive industrialist who founded the Ford Motor Company and pioneered in assembly-line methods of mass production. One of the most popular series ever published for young Americans, these classics of childhood have been praised alike by parents, teachers, and librarians. These lively, inspiring, believable biographies sweep today's young readers right into history.
